Its name is "mylo," which is short for "my life online," and it looks like it could be the PSP's little brother. It has the basic and familiar PSP shape, a directional pad and a 2.4-inch screen, but if you look closely at the unit itself and its specs, you'll see that this is a completely different animal.

Sony says mylo is a handheld communication and media system. See something missing? That's right, "gaming" is not included in that list. mylo doesn't have a UMD drive and it's not designed for gaming. Instead, it has a slide-out keyboard for instant messaging and emailing, and supports voice messaging programs such as Skype and Google Talk...

...There are a few features that the mylo has in common with the PSP beyond its look. Like the PSP, it can play back movies from a Memory Stick Duo. It also has web browsing capabilities and Wi-Fi support. This feature-filled handheld device is scheduled to come out in September and will cost about $350.
